Key Differences
In short — CyberpowerPC Luxe outperforms the cheaper Memory on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Memory is a better bang for your buck.
Advantages of Memory PC
- Up to 15% cheaper than CyberpowerPC Luxe - €1009.0 vs €1191.73
- Up to 6% better value when playing God of War than CyberpowerPC Luxe - €15.06 vs €16.1 per FPS
Advantages of CyberpowerPC Luxe PC
- Performs up to 10% better in God of War than Memory - 74 vs 67 FPS
